PROBLEM

ArcGIS Monitor 2024.1.1 crashes immediately after startup

Last Published: July 17, 2025

Description

When attempting to start ArcGIS Monitor 2024.1.1, the service initiates and briefly displays a "Running" status in the Windows Services console. However, within a few seconds, the status reverts to a blank state, indicating the service has stopped unexpectedly. ArcGIS Monitor displays no error messages, and the application fails to remain active.

Cause

The CONFIG_STORE_PATH variable in the .env file has the wrong ArcGIS Monitor account, pointing to the default 'arcgis' user instead of the intended domain account due to a failed installation.

Solution or Workaround

Note:
The AppData folder is hidden by default. Refer to the Show hidden files drop-down in Microsoft Support: Common File Explorer options for instructions to display hidden folders.
  1. On the ArcGIS Monitor machine, in File Explorer, navigate to the .env file, which by default is located in:
C:\Users\<ArcGIS Monitor Domain Account>\AppData\Local\ESRI\ArcGISMonitor\config-store-server
  1. Right-click the .env file and open the file in a text editor, for example, Notepad.
  2. In the text editor, navigate to the CONFIG_STORE_PATH variable.
  3. Edit the domain account in the file path to include the user's domain account. An example of the edited file path is:
C:\Users\<ArcGIS Monitor Domain Account>\AppData\Local\ESRI\ArcGISMonitor\config-store-server
  1. Save the .env file and close the text editor.
